Narrative:
The chartered flight from Rouyn to Ottawa with three crew and 24 passengers, most school children, took off about 16:00 from Rouyn Airport, but landed minutes later at Val-d'Or Airport for unknown reasons. Took off again short time later and crashed near or at the end of the runway.
